Where Did This Odd Idea Come From?
So, where did this peculiar notion of bunnies with tentacles originate? Tracing the exact genesis of this whimsical creature is a bit like chasing a rabbit down a hole – you might find some interesting things along the way, but the starting point remains elusive. It's challenging to pinpoint a singular origin because the concept likely evolved organically through the collective imagination of artists, writers, and dreamers. Perhaps it began as a simple doodle in a sketchbook, a random thought experiment, or a playful twist on familiar folklore. One thing is for sure: the internet has played a significant role in popularizing and spreading the idea. Online communities, art platforms, and meme culture have all contributed to the proliferation of bunnies with tentacles, transforming them from a niche concept into a recognizable and widely shared image. It's also worth considering the influence of existing mythological and fictional creatures. Think of creatures like the Wolpertinger, a Bavarian forest animal with the body of a hare, the antlers of a deer, the wings of a duck, and the tail of a fox. Or even the Japanese Amabie, a mermaid-like yokai with three legs, who rose to prominence during the recent pandemic. These hybrid creatures, blending different animal features, paved the way for accepting and embracing the idea of unconventional beings like tentacled bunnies. The appeal may also stem from a deeper fascination with the unknown and the monstrous. Tentacles, often associated with sea monsters and otherworldly entities, evoke a sense of mystery and power. By combining them with the harmless image of a bunny, we create a creature that is both unsettling and endearing, tapping into our primal instincts and sparking our curiosity.
